The author critiques the common belief that violence is an unavoidable aspect of politics, arguing that this view stems from overly broad definitions of violence and a limited understanding of politics confined to traditional institutions. Oksala challenges readers to reconsider these assumptions, suggesting a more nuanced perspective that separates the theoretical concept of violence from its practical implications in political contexts.
